E-mails & Netiquette • Reply within 24 hours • Anti-Spam measures & non-receipt • Avoid language that may be construed as intemperate • Use lower case with emoticons • Include one level of history underneath • Hide addresses not intimately involved in the conversation • Don’t forward spoofs or virus warnings • Don’t click a hyperlink

Backups & Disaster Planning • Your hardware WILL fail, it will happen at the most inopportune time. • Duplicate irreplaceable photos, music, letters… • Dangers • Frequency • Medium • Software • Plan and practice recovery procedure • Redundancy
